  17. NAND Flasher 360 for XBOX v1.2.0 by trancy (www.modcontrol.com) 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 What is the NAND Flasher 360 for XBOX? The NAND Flasher 360 is a NAND -flash program for XBOX 360 (XeX Version). With this program you can update to a new version of freeboot within minutes. The Data gets verified for each extraction and writing step. Bad blocks automatically get moved to the appropriate positions (Bad block management). This works for the small as well as the larger NANDs (16/256/512MB). Information on the hardware and NAND is also displayed.   18. Originally posted on XboxHacker.org by ravendrow ok so i have seen and fixed alot of 0022 errors as of recent, mostly new comers trying to RGH their xboxes for the first time. Most of the damage i have seen has been the standard pulled up pll bypass point but i have seen quite a few boards that the pll bypass seems fine and still 0022, under magnification i noticed that a small amount of solder can bridge the pads of the R7R17 resistor( the one right next to pll_bypass) and that this was what was causing the error. to fix this i just removed the R7R17 Resistor and used a 10k 5% resistor (thanks to the rgloader IRC guys who gave me the resistor value) and some kynar wire to repair the damage and thats it 50 + units boot like a charm again. here is a pic of what i am suggesting dont rip on me for the crappy paint work i did it in like 5 minutes but it gives you the idea. oh yeah also you can use a 10k 2% if that is all you have but it should be a 10k 5%. hopes this helps at least one of you who can't quite figure out a PHAT Board

  21. We have been keeping a little secret.. the kind that is so much fun to share when the time comes. Today we announce XBMC for Android. Not a remote, not a thin client; the real deal. No root or jailbreak required. XBMC can be launched as an application on your set-top-box, tablet, phone, or wherever else Android may be found. The feature-set on Android is the same that you have come to expect from XBMC, no different from its cousin on the desktop. Running your favorite media-center software on small, cheap, embedded hardware is about to become a hassle-free reality. And as Android-based set-top-boxes are becoming more and more ubiquitous, it couldn’t be a better time. In fact, primary development was done on a Pivos XIOS DS set-top-box. And that is no coincidence, you will notice that Pivos is now listed as an official sponsor (more on that later). XBMC is stable and works great there, as well as on various tablets and phones. Though with Android, as many of you probably know, that is only the beginning of the story. Enjoy the stereotypical dev-shot low-quality demo video. More video, including phone/tablet usage in the next post. http-~~-//www.youtube.com/watch?v=y4o-k1DxF5w So what’s the catch? None… in time. Currently, for most devices only software decode of audio and video is hooked up. We considered waiting until universal hardware decode was ready before making our announcement, but in the end decided that in the spirit of keeping things open and working with our ever-expanding community, it made sense to open up sooner rather than later. We are confident that an OpenMax-based player (similar to the one used for the Raspberry Pi) will spring up very quickly. That said, software playback of most media plays quite well already. Though, there is one exception. As Pivos sponsored a large portion of the port, we were able to work with their vendors to achieve buttery-smooth hardware-accelerated playback on the XIOS DS. It remains to be seen if such hardware-specific features will make it into XBMC mainline or exist as patches for vendors to integrate. While, as you can see in the video, the port is fully usable and lots of fun to play with, it’s not quite ready for prime-time. We will begin releasing apks for interested beta testers in the coming weeks. But for those who are up to the task, as you would expect from XBMC, the source code is available. We have decided not to push to Google Play until we are satisfied that users with all kinds of devices get the same great XBMC experience. We ask that our users stay on the lookout for evil-doers trying to cash in on XBMC’s popularity. If you see anyone masquerading as XBMC, please be sure to let us and Google know about it. There is also the issue of having a proper UI for small-screen devices. Typically, XBMC skins have been designed for use on a TV, so use on a small phone can be clunky. But there is nothing keeping skinners from creating more functional touch-oriented skins, like the included “Touched” skin from Jezz_X. With the community’s help, we’re sure to have a more refined version available for inclusion by the time we release a stable version. There are still many details left to iron out, mainly related to the wide variety of Android devices in the wild. We have not yet decided what minimum requirements will be set, due simply to the lack of extensive testing on exotic devices. As for taking advantage of Android itself, we haven’t even scratched the surface. There are so many interesting features that we could take advantage of: launching apps, location awareness, speech recognition, on and on. Once the core port is finished up, you can bet we’ll be exploring many new avenues. INGAME CONTROLS --------------- During ingame operation you can do some extra actions: Right Thumb Stick - Down - Fast-forwards the game Right Thumb Stick - Up - Rewinds the game in real-time ('Rewind' has to be enabled in the 'Settings' screen - warning - comes at a slight performance decrease but will be worth it if you love this feature) RStick Left + RT - Decrease save state slot Rtick Right + RT - Increase save state slot RStick Up + RT - Load selected save state slot RStick Down + RT - Save selected save state slot Right Thumb + Left Thumb - Go back to 'Menu'/'Quick Menu' WHAT IS RETROARCH? ------------------ RetroArch is a modular multi-system emulator system that is designed to be fast, lightweight and portable. It has features few other emulator frontends have, such as real-time rewinding and game-aware shading. WHAT IS LIBRETRO? ----------------- Libretro is the API that RetroArch uses. It makes it easy to port games and emulators to a single core backend, such as RetroArch. For the user, this means - more ports to play with, more crossplatform portability, less worrying about developers having to reinvent the wheel writing boilerplate UI/port code - so that they can get busy with writing the emulator/porting the emulator/game. WHAT'S THE BIG DEAL? -------------------- Right now it's unique in that it runs the same emulator cores on multiple systems (such as Xbox 360, PS3, PC, Wii, etc). For each emulator 'core', RetroArch makes use of a library API that we like to call 'libretro'. Think of libretro as an interface for emulator and game ports. You can make a libretro port once and expect the same code to run on all the platforms that RetroArch supports. It's designed with simplicity and ease of use in mind so that the porter can worry about the port at hand instead of having to wrestle with an obfuscatory API. The purpose of libretro is to help ease the work of the emulator/game porter by giving him an API that allows him to target multiple platforms at once without having to redo any code. He doesn't have to worry about writing input/video/audio drivers - all of that is supplied to him by RetroArch. All he has to do is to have the emulator port hook into the libretro API and that's it - we take care of the rest.
